The Process of Choose the Right Real Estate Consultant


Finding a suitable real estate consultant is crucial for managing the complexities of your property market. Start by looking for recommendations from relatives, colleagues who have recently engaged a consultant. Additionally, checking online reviews and testimonials can give valuable insights into the consultant’s track record and customer satisfaction. Create a list of potential candidates and confirm they have relevant experience in your targeted area and property category.


After you have narrowed down your options, it’s important to discuss with each consultant. Prepare questions focused on their experience, negotiation skills, and understanding of market trends. Pay attention to how clearly they listen to your needs and whether they convey information effectively.


In conclusion, evaluate the consultant’s network and resources. A well-networked real estate consultant can connect you with potential buyers, visibility for listings, and access to relevant industry insights. Assess their commitment to ongoing education and keeping current with market changes. A consultant who is forward-thinking and well-informed will be more capable to realize the maximum potential of your property.
